ASSEMBLY INSTRUCTIONS
STEP 31 — Climbing Rope:
Push one end of the Climbing Rope (AV) through the hole in
the Right Wall Support. Tie a gure-eight knot at the end of
the rope, inside the gym. Leave at least 3" of rope extending
beyond the knot inside the gym.
From the outside of the gym, tie an overhand knot approxi-
mately every 11" along the length of the rope. Make sure
each knot is tight.
Push the loose end of the rope through the hole in the Bot-
tom Rope Support. Pull the rope taut and tie a gure-eight
knot to secure it.
Set the Climber Rails into the playground surface to en-
sure that the bottom rope connection is as close to the
ground as possible.
IMPORTANT: Check the rope often. At no time should
the bottom end of the rope be untied or the rope loose
enough to form a loop. This presents extreme danger to
your children.

STEP 30 — Hand Grips to Entrance Slats:
Fasten one Hand Grip (AU) to each Entrance Slat above
the Rock Climber using two 1/4 x 1" Hex Bolt Assemblies
for each.
